Channel 7 News Reporter and Journalist Ameera David Speaks to Students in our Journalism Classes at Stout

Channel 7 news reporter and Emmy award winning journalist Ameera David was a guest speaker at Stout today. She spoke to the students who are in our journalism classes this semester. One of her main messages that she spoke about was, “Being a great writer will open doors for you so work hard at it.”

STEM Classes in Action at Stout Middle School

The students in our STEM classes are creating catapults that they have designed as teams. They used their math and science skills to first draw prototype designs with measurements and details that they engineered into a real product. Our Stout Falcons are just loving their STEM elective.
